#ca5e44 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ca5e44 is composed of 79.2% red, 36.9%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.5% magenta, 66.3%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 11.6 degrees, a saturation of 55.8% and a lightness of 52.9%. #ca5e44 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bc88 with #950000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#ca5e44 color description : Moderate red.

#ca5e44 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ca5e44 has RGB values of R:202, G:94,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.53, Y:0.66,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13262404.

Shades and Tints of #ca5e44

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0503 is the darkest color, while #fefc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#ca5e44

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898685 is the less saturated color, while #f84216 is the most saturated one.
